In case you missed it, there is a warning on the Ace Lab blog about the Seagate Rosewoods. They are saying that special features in the firmware require handling these drives in a different manner than you might some other families. Reset SMART could lose data! Here are things you should not do because it could clear media cache and lose customer data for good.
1) Don't recount translator (ATA or Terminal)
2) Don't clear G-List
3) Don't reset SMART
4) Don't spare heads in ROM
